elvish(1) General Commands Manual elvish(1)

NAME

elvish - Friendly and expressive shell

SYNOPSIS

elvish [flags] [script]

FLAGS

-bin string
path to the elvish binary
-buildinfo
show build info and quit
-c
take first argument as a command to execute
-compileonly
Parse/Compile but do not execute
-cpuprofile string
write cpu profile to file
-daemon
run daemon instead of shell
-db string
path to the database
-help
show usage help and quit
-json
show output in JSON. Useful with -buildinfo.
-log string
a file to write debug log to
-logprefix string
the prefix for the daemon log file
-port int
the port of the web backend (default 3171)
-sock string
path to the daemon socket
-web
run backend of web interface

DESCRIPTION

Elvish is a cross-platform shell, supporting Linux, BSDs and Windows. It features an expressive programming language, with features like namespacing and anonymous functions, and a fully programmable user interface with friendly defaults. It is suitable for both interactive use and scripting.
